本篇文章给大家谈谈java语言中数值数据,以及Java数值数据类型对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、Java语言中数据的存储位数越多类型的级别越高正确吗?
- 2、Java当数值型数据和字符型数据同时出现时怎样正确读取例题
- 3、Java的基本数据类型有哪些?
- 4、一、java中数据类型转换问题:(1)如何将数值型字符转换为数字(Integer...
- 5、Java语言中的浮点型数据的float和double的单精度和双精度到底是啥意思...
- 6、数组是基本类型吗?java中基本数据类型分类有哪些
J***a语言中数据的存储位数越多类型的级别越高正确吗?
1、相比之下当然位数愈多精度愈高了,其他整数类型的精度就简单了,首位表示正负,所有的都表示数值,位数越高当然精度越高。
2、J***A中一共有八种基本数据类型,分别是:byte、short、int、long、float、double、char、boolean。byte:8位,最大存储数据量是255,存放的数据范围是-128~127之间。
3、double型比float型存储范围更大,精度更高,所以通常的浮点型的数据在不声明的情况下都是double型的,如果要表示一个数据是float型的,可以在数据后面加上“F”。
J***a当数值型数据和字符型数据同时出现时怎样正确读取例题
首先创建一个Scanner对象s,构造函数的初始值为System.in,再利用s.nextInt()来接收一个int型数据ival的值,用s.nextLine()来接收类型的name,然后分别输出。
J***a语言的数据类型有哪些?8 有byte(字节型)、char(字符型)、boolean(布尔型)、short(短整型)、int(整型)、long(长整型)、浮点型:float(单精度)、double(双精度)。
对象引用实例变量的缺省值为 null,而原始类型实例变量的缺省值与它们的类型有关。String 和StringBuffer 的区别J***A 平台提供了两个类:String 和StringBuffer,它们可以储存和操作字符串,即包含多个字符的字符数据。
您好,j***a编程语言实现输入数据和查询数据可通过System.in读取标准输入设备数据(从标准输入获取数据,一般是键盘),其数据类型为InputStream。
J***a的基本数据类型有哪些?
1、基本数据类型如下:整数型:byte、short、int、long。浮点型:float、double.字符型:char。布尔型:boolean。
2、j***a中有8种基本数据类型:byte(最小的数据类型)、short(短整型)、int(整型)、long(长整型)、float(浮点型)、double(双精度浮点型)、char(字符型)、boolean(布尔型)。
3、第四类:字符型 char 在栈中可以直接分配内存的数据是基本数据类型。引用数据类型:是数据的引用在栈中,但是他的对象在堆中。要想学好J***a必须知道各种数据的在内存中存储位置。
一、j***a中数据类型转换问题:(1)如何将数值型字符转换为数字(Integer...
1、如你要将一个字符串转化为数字,可以调用Integer.parseInt(String s)方法来实现。这个Integer就是int对应的包装类。
2、将Integer转化为int,我们使用方法Integer.intValue(),方法的返回值为int类型。以上步骤以int整数类型为例,介绍了字符串到整数的数值转换。
3、首先创建一个String类型的数字数组,如下图所示。然后在这个数据中,使用Integer[] intArray = Convert.toIntArray(b);进行转换,如下图所示。运行程序展示结果,如下图所示。
4、函数来检测),直到遇上数字或正负符号才开始做转换,而再遇到非数字或字符串结束时(\0)才结束转换,并将结果返回。【返回值】返回转换后的整型数;如果 str 不能转换成 int 或者 str 为空字符串,那么将返回 0。
5、a+,通过‘+’链接,将整型强制转换一下字符串。System.out.println(a+).getClass();String.valueOf(a),通过方法转换为字符串。
J***a语言中的浮点型数据的float和double的单精度和双精度到底是啥意思...
float属于单精度型浮点数据。double属于双精度型浮点数据。[_a***_]范围不同 float的指数范围为-127~128。
计算机数据存储长度最小单位是一个字节8位,而实际使用的数据仅用8位是远远不够,所以将具有32位的数据长度和64位的数据长度分别给所谓的单精度(float型)和双精度(double型)使用,以便能表达更大数值范围内的数据。
指代不同 单精度:是指计算机表达实数近似值的一种方式。双精度:此数据类型与单精度数据类型(float)相似,但精确度比float高。
你想歪了,单双精度是指在内存中占用2个字节运行的意思。。
单精度型和双精度型的区别在于它们的精确程度不一样,也就是小数部分的有效位数不一样。
float占4个字节,也就是32位。double占8个字节,也就是64位。指数域位数不同 float的指数域是8位,可表达的范围为0~255。double的指数域是11位,可表达的范围为0~2047。
数组是基本类型吗?j***a中基本数据类型分类有哪些
j***a有八个基本数据类型:int ,short,long,boolean,String,char,double,float。还包括引用数据类型:类,接口,数组。所以,数组是属于引用数据类型,并不是什么类。
基本类型:简单数据类型是不能简化的、内置的数据类型、由编程语言本身定义,它表示了真实的数字、字符和整数。
不是。基本类型只有八种:int byte short long float boolean double char 获取以为数组长度:例如:String[] str = {11,22,33};int strlength = str.length;这个strlength即这个数组的长度。
基本数据类型有:1 整数类型 byte,short,int,long. 2 浮点型:float,double, 字符型:char. 转义字符 4 布尔型 boolean 注意:string不属于基本数据类型,string可以用于创建字符串。
所以在定义的 float 型数据后面加F 或 f;double 类型可不写后缀,但在小数计算中一定要写 D 或 X.X float 的精度没有 long 高,有效位数(尾数)短。 float 的范围大于 long 指数可以很大。
j***a语言中数值数据的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于j***a数值数据类型、j***a语言中数值数据的信息别忘了在本站进行查找喔。